
Prevent the pollution of your tank water
The First Flush water Diverter made by Rain Harvesting is a simple but very effective tool to help you store clean rain water.
Water caught from any roof will have a variety of contaminants mixed with it including animal droppings, bacteria from decomposed insects or animals, sediments and other air and water borne pollutants. How does the First Flush Diverter work?

When it first rains, water slowly builds up on the roof and in the roof guttering system. This then washes contaminants along the guttering before it exits through the downpipe. As the contaminated water flows through the downpipe it gets diverted into the flushing chamber. This chamber fills up with water, and as the level rises a floating ball rises with it, eventually closing the chamber.
This then diverts the cleaner water to the water tanks. This system allows for the flushing of contaminants off the roof and guttering by diverting the dirtiest water. In doing so it will reduce water tank maintenance and protect any attached water pumps.
By using a floating ball and seat, this system prevents the contaminated water from being suctioned out of the chamber and into the water tank.

The amount of contaminated water that is flushed can be adjusted by varying the length of the PVC chamber. This can be set when the First Flush is installed. The First Flush will reset automatically by slowly draining itself after rain. It can do so by using an inbuilt slow release valve. The amount of self draining can be adjusted by changing the slow release valve with one of the many supplied.

The chamber has a screw cap which can be removed for regular maintenance. This cap houses the slow release valve and a plastic filter. The filter is there to prevent any large particles from clogging the slow release valve.
